About the name DOROTHEA

Dorothea, a name steeped in history and grace, is derived from the Greek "Dorotheos," meaning "gift of God." This melodic name carries a sense of warmth and benevolence, evoking images of kindness and nurturing spirits. With roots tracing back to ancient Greece, where it was borne by early saints and scholars, Dorothea is a name that has traversed time and borders. Its popularity has flourished in various cultures, particularly in Eastern Europe, with a pronounced presence in countries like Germany, Poland, and Hungary, where it is often affectionately shortened to Dottie or Thea. In literature and the arts, Dorothea has been depicted as a character of depth and strength, symbolizing resilience and the ability to inspire others.
